Address 0 PPC

PMnFeeMkcNR54SaF6rvfCSAwetozT35z4E

Confirmed

Total Received54.086468 PPC
Total Sent54.086468 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PMnFeeMkcNR54SaF6rvfCSAwetozT35z4E54.086468 PPC
Fee: 0.01 PPC
671676 Confirmations54.076468 PPC
PMnFeeMkcNR54SaF6rvfCSAwetozT35z4E54.086468 PPC
PWWN5xryF5vjzWZGfCHymNNiYVCyTP9eQY1.438229 PPC
Fee: 0.01 PPC
671678 Confirmations55.524697 PPC